> >> Here is how I handle events: >> >> Objective, to download several files, very similar to the Httpasy demo: >> On GoButton.Click: HttpCli.GetASync >> OnHeaderEnd: Check if the file to be downloaded is good. If not, ABORT. >> OnRequestDone: If ABORT, then clear the file, if not store the downloaded >> file. Then get the next file. > > Ah ! That's better explanation. >>From the OnHeaderEnd, set a flag to remember the file is not good and then > use PostMessage with a cutom message. From the event handler, call Abort > if > OnRequestDone has not been called already. From the OnRequestDone event, > check your flag to know if the file is OK or not and process accordingly. > Ignore any error condition if the flag is set because Abort has been > called. > > It is always better to use PostMessage to defer any processing out of any > event handler. At the time an custom message is handled, the component is > out of his own work. If you put the processing in the event handler and > this > processing involve the component itself, then it is likely you'll have > problems because when the event handler is returns, the component continue > what it has started and which maybe the wrong thing if you changed the > instructions ! Of course it the processing doesnt' involve the component > itself, there is no problem. > >> The problem is that IF the statuscode is 302 and I Abort, then I cannot >> get >> the next file because the component is busy. (httpDNSLookup). > > You can turn "followRelocation" to false and handle the relocation > yourself > if this problem still happend with the change I outlined above. > >> My question is: Is there a bug in the component, or is there a better >> method of doing this? > > No bug that I'm aware.
